Transaction e30661ea3646b22440a56aa730e5a12889827bb02e873545ab051c47d2342fa9
1 Input
1 Output
-
e30661ea3646b22440a56aa730e5a12889827bb02e873545ab051c47d2342fa9:0
- value
- 72657220
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bed7cf78f429f7fa24bcddb74f5c4f97ab3b6de0 OP_EQUAL
- address
- 3K66qmFTkAVfaRvRrMABd7YyG16FcUAd1n